Nicholas was the son of Emanuel Den, Esq., of Kilkenny, Ireland. He studied medicine and then went to sea. Dr. Nicholas Augustus Den reached Santa Bárbara, Alta California, México, by sea, coming by way of Monterey, on July 8, 1836. He was so impressed by the kindness and generosity of the Californios that he decided to stay. At Santa Bárbara he made the acquaintance of Daniel Hill and later married his daughter, Rafaela Rosa Antonia Hill y Ortega, at Mission Santa Ynez on June 1, 1843, the same year his younger brothers, Dr. Richard Somerset Den and William Alfred Den, arrived in Alta California from Ireland. William died just a few years later at San Francisco Oct. 6, 1849 (Weekly Alta California, Vol. I, No. 41, Oct. 11, 1849; 3:1). Nicholas engaged in stock-raising and served as the town's doctor. Dr. Den had at the time of his death 10,000 head of cattle and owned the ranchos of San Marcos, Dos Pueblos, Cañada del Corral, and Tequepís. He was survived by his wife, Rafaela, and 11 children.

Children:
- Catarina María (1844-1926; m. John S. Bell)
- Manuel (1846-1846)
- Emanuel Ricardo (May 1847-Jun. 25, 1923; m. Frances Allen (1862-1917; ch: Eleanor Josephine Den [1883-1946])
- María Rosa Viviana (1848-1859)
- Nicolás Constantine (Sep. 1849-Jan. 13, 1902)
- William Alfred (Aug. 30, 1851-Dec. 13, 1897; m. [1] Jennie; m. [2] Nellie Pommier [18??-1906], ch: ?? [1890-after 1906], Wm. Alfred [May 31, 1893-Nov. 13, 1950], Anita María Elena [Dec. 15, 1896-Sep. 4, 1995]; Nellie m. [2] Antonio Conterio)
- María Ysabel (1852-Aft 1883)
- Alfonso Lorenzo (1854-1947; m. [1] Edwina Meyer; m. [2] Lydia Taylor)
- Alfredo W. Emigdio (1855-Apr. 19, 1882)
- Augustus H. (1857-1919; m. Winifred Devine)
- María T. (1858-1915; m. Thomas R. More)
- María Rosa (1859-1878)
- María Susana (1861-1949; m. Edward Tyler)
